What You’ll Be Doing
As a Community Care Assistant, you’ll provide high-quality, person-centred care that enables people to remain safe, independent and comfortable within their own homes.
Your duties may include:
- Personal care
- Moving and handling
- Medication support
- Meal preparation
- Companionship
- Mobility assistance
- Promoting independence
- Accurate digital care recording
